vimarsana.com
Home
Visual Communication Systems
Top Locations Tagged with Visual Communication Systems
Visual Communication Systems in United States - 89144/Business-consultant near Clark
1). Visual Communication Systems, Cardinal Crest Ln
Visual Communication Systems in United States - 43082/Home-theatre near Delaware
2). Audio Visual Communication Systems, Harlem Rd
vimarsana © 2020. All Rights Reserved.